[PATCH] swiotlb: remove duplicated swiotlb_late_init_with_default_size
declarations

This adds swiotlb_late_init_with_default_size declaration to the
common header so that we can remove duplicated
swiotlb_late_init_with_default_size declarations in the IOMMU drivers.
